The File History report is an HTML-formatted report sent through email. This report displays a list of major file actions within a selected folder and its subfolders, the username who performed the action, and the exact date and time of the action (all date/times displayed in Central Standard Time, GMT -0600).
File actions logged in the Email Export include:
Upload: Each file uploaded. For Multi-Uploads, each file is shown separately for detailed tracking.
Download: Each file downloaded. For Multi-Downloads, each file is shown separately for detailed tracking.
File Share Access: Each file accessed from a File Share. The logging occurs the moment the share recipient clicks the "Download" button on the File Share page.
Delete: Each time a file is deleted. When an entire folder is deleted, each file that is deleted in the folder and subfolders is logged separately for detailed tracking.

Include Subfolders: Activity for all files contained within all subfolders of the selected folder will also be included in the report. If you uncheck this option, only files within the immediate selected folder will be reported on.
From Date: The beginning date from which all file activity will be reported (from 12:00 AM Central Time of the selected date).
To Date: The ending date through which all file activity will be reported. Activity is reported through the end of the selected day (up to 11:59:59 PM Central Time of the selected date).
Email To: Recipient email address where the email is sent. You may specify multiple addresses separated by semicolons (;). This email address defaults to the registered email address in your user profile.
A variation of this report is available for export (download). Clicking "Export to Excel" will create and download a file displaying the full set of results from your Version History query (the same as the results displayed when paging through all Version History records online). The Export file is actually a tab-delimited text file, and if you have Microsoft Excel on your computer it will automatically open in Excel. Tip: save this file as an Excel document if you make any changes, to preserve formatting.
